    About NSD. The National School of Drama is one of the foremost theatre training institutions in the world and the only one of its kind in India. It was set up by the Sangeet Natak Akademi as one of its constituent units in 1959. In 1975, it became an independent entity and was registered as an autonomous organization under the Societies ...

National School of Drama, Varanasi is a new extension center of National School of Drama, New Delhi, established in 2018 to provide one-year training on Indian Classical Theatre and Natyashashtra.   7. 3 giorni fa · Training at the National School of Drama. The National School of Drama provides a three year full time post-graduate diploma course in dramatic arts. Aims. The central aim of the course is to prepare the students in the practice of theatre. To this end, a variety of practical skills must be developed and a corpus of knowledge acquired.
